XStoreShowPurchaseUIResult

获取调用 XStoreShowPurchaseUIAsync 的结果。

语法

HRESULT XStoreShowPurchaseUIResult(  
         XAsyncBlock* async  
)  

参数

async _Inout_
类型:XAsyncBlock*

传递给 XStoreShowPurchaseUIAsync 的 XAsyncBlock。 XAsyncBlock 可用于轮询调用的状态和检索调用结果。 有关详细信息,请参阅 XAsyncBlock

返回值

类型:HRESULT

HRESULT 成功或错误代码。

S_OK 指示已完成购买,但在授予对内容的访问权限之前,应始终刷新用户的许可证和集合数据

E_ABORT 指示用户取消了购买流程。

备注

此结果函数让您可以检索 XStoreShowPurchaseUIAsync 的执行结果。 因此,应在调用 XStoreShowPurchaseUIAsync 之后调用此函数,并且通常是在回调函数的上下文中。 如果要查明 UI 在发生故障时未显示的原因,此函数尤其有用。

有关使用示例,请参阅 XStoreShowPurchaseUIAsync

要求

头文件:XStore.h(包含在 XGameRuntime.h 中)

库:xgameruntime.lib

支持平台:Windows、Xbox One 系列主机和 Xbox Series 主机

另请参阅

XStore
XStoreShowPurchaseUIAsync